At the end of term one, students competed in our inter-house cross-country carnival, with Coolac coming home the winners.
There were 30 students who then qualified for the Mac Zone region.
These students will compete next week in Inglewood, we wish them all the best.
Congratulations to our swimming competitors Leah S, Braithen S and Halle B, who represented Darling Downs at the recent State Swimming titles in Brisbane.
All three swimmers managed to create some new personal bests at the carnival.
Student council
In term one we elected our Student Representative Council.
Congratulations to:
- School captain Caroline Mayers
- Year 6 leaders Molly Coventry and Matthew Lang
- House captains - Coolac Sarah Ward, Dante Putzolu, Amelie Moore and Braithen Scott; Burilda Ben Campbell, Macalister Ramsay and William Spriggs.
Members of the Student Representative Council are:
- Caroline Mayers (president)
- Jack Roser (secretary)
- Jack Thompson (treasurer)
- Sarah Ward (publicity officer)
- Molly Coventry (vice-president).
SRC meetings are held every four to five weeks where discussions and decisions are made on issues such as fundraisers, socials, school events and how to assist with school improvement initiatives.
